    Applicant: BASF AG

    Abstract: A moulding material which is capable of being shaped and cured by press moulding in the temperature range 70 DEG to 250 DEG C. contains (1) at least one filler and/or reinforcing material (I); (2) at least one polymerizable ethylenically unsaturated polyester having a molecular weight of from 750 to 3000 and a softening point within the range 35 DEG to 250 DEG C. (II); (3) at least one organic peroxide having a decomposition point with the range 50 DEG to 250 DEG C. (III); (4) di - methallyl - terephthalate (IV); and optionally (5) one or more polymerizable ethylenically unsaturated monomeric compounds (V) other than di-methallyl-terephthalate; in the weight ratios of (I): (II + III + IV + V) of from 0.1 to 4, (II): (IV + V) of from 0.2 to 9, (III): (II + IV + V) of from 0.005 to 0.09, and (V): (IV) of less than 1. Lists of components I, II, III, and V are given and conventional additives may also be added to the moulding material. In the examples: (1) A polyester formed from maleic acid and propane-diol-1,2 is copolymerized with di - methallyl - terephthalate using dibenzoyl peroxide in dibutyl phthalate, there being present asbestos powder and optionally glass fibre cuttings having a length of 13 mm.; (2) a polyester formed from isophthalic and maleic acids and propane-diol-1,2 is copolymerized with dimethallyl-terephthalate and diallyl phthalate in the presence of chalk; (3) the polyester of Example (2) is copolymerized with di-methallyl-terephthalate using tertiary-butyl perbenzoate and the mixture is used to impregnate glass fibre fabric.

    Applicant: BASF AG

    Abstract: A catalyst for use in converting N-formyl amines to the corresponding nitriles is prepared by treating a silica gel containing 90% of pores with a radius ranging between 10 and 200 , the mean pore radius being 48,9 , and having an internal surface of 314 square metres per gram and an exchange acidity of between pH 5 and 6,6, with an alcoholic solution of titanium tetrachloride, allowing to stand in air for 15 minutes, treating with water and finally heating in a current of ammonia for 10 hours at 300 DEG C. Specification 263,198 is referred to.ALSO:Nitriles are prepared by reacting an N-formylated primary amino compound at 400 DEG to 600 DEG C in the gas phase on a catalyst of silicic acid gel or a silicate, said materials having more than 50% of pores with a radius ranging from 10 to 200 , a mean pore radius of 20 to 100 and an internal surface of less than 550 square metres per gram. The catalyst preferably additionally contains an oxide of a metal of one of the Group III to VI of the Periodic System and may be regenerated by heating to between 400 and 750 DEG C. in a current of oxygen or oxygen-containing gas, followed, if desired, by treatment with a dilute acid. The N-formylated amine reactant may be prepared from the appropriate amine and formic acid or an ester thereof in a zone of elevated temperature preceding the catalyst zone. Starting materials may be aliphatic, aromatic or heterocyclic in nature and may be further substituted by methoxy, chloro and nitrile substituents, as well as containing more than one formylamino group. The examples describe the preparation of benzonitrile, ortho-and para-tolunitriles, ortho-chlorobenzonitrile (saponified to ortho-chlorobenzoic acid), alpha - naphthonitrile, hexahydrobenzonitrile, benzyl cyanide, acetonitrile, suberic acid dinitrile, amino-oenanthic nitrile, sebacic acid dinitrile and omega-amino-pelargonic nitrile.     Applicant: BASF AG

    Abstract: Comminuted polyamide is mixed with 0,5 to 10% of a compound H2NOL-COOR; R being hydrogen, aliphatic, cycloaliphatic or an aromatic radical, and heated above the softening point, but below the decomposition point, of the polamide, but to at least 250 DEG C. to give an expanded product. The polyamide may be linear or crosslinked e.g. by irradiation, by heating with formaldehyde, or by polyfunctional compounds, The mixture of hydroxy alkyl diamine and ester of Specification 858,105 may also be present, and the polyamide formers are the same as in that Specification.ALSO:Comminuted polyamide is mixed with 0,5 to 10% of a compound H2Nlc COO R; R being hydrogen an aliphatic, cycloaliphatic or an aromatic radicle, and heated above the softening point, but below the decomposition point, of the polyamide, but to at least 250 DEG C., to give an expanded product.
